Newsbrief: Last year, Ubisoft launched its Graduate Program, which helps recent college grads transition into a two-year stint at its studios, in which they're treated as employees in either programming or project management.

This year, the company has added its Singapore studio, bringing 13 of its global studios to the roster, and split the single "programming" opportunity into gameplay and online specializations.
